time.h time_t
2024-10-20 13:40:53
#include <stdio.h> #include <stddef.h> #include <time.h> int main(void) { time_t timer;//time_t就是long int 类型 struct tm *tblock; //time()获取当前的系统时间,返回的结果是一个time_t类型,其实就是一个大整数, //其值表示从CUT(Coordinated Universal Time)时间1970年1月1日00:00:00(称为UNIX系统的Epoch时间)到当前时刻的秒数。 timer = time(NULL);//这一句也可以改成time(&timer); printf("The number of seconds since January 1, 1970 is %ld\n",timer); //然后调用localtime将time_t所表示的CUT时间转换为本地时间,并转成struct tm类型, //该类型的各数据成员分别表示年月日时分秒。 tblock = localtime(&timer); //asctime把指向的tm结构体中储存的时间转换为字符串字符串格式 printf("Local time is: %s\n",asctime(tblock)); printf(,tblock->tm_mon+,tblock->tm_mday,tblock->tm_hour,tblock->tm_min,tblock->tm_sec); ; } //time()结合其他函数(如:localtime、gmtime、asctime、ctime)可以获得当前系统时间或是标准时间。
最新文章
- 【原创】安装LoadRunner12.53 版本时出现Critical error的解决方法
- A股各概念板块龙头股大全
- CSU 1325 莫比乌斯反演
- 泛——复习js高级第三版
- 第六十三篇、runtime实现归解档
- iOS开发——OC篇&;消息传递机制(KVO/NOtification/Block/代理/Target-Action)
- Java内存分配和GC
- t持久化与集群部署开发详解
- PIC单片机状态寄存器中的C(进位/借位位标志)
- float和position
- 获取Iframe页面高度并赋值给Iframe以及获取iframe里的元素
- webpack(import路径配置)(自动打开浏览器)(自定义运行命令)
- vue项目中的tab页实现
- UVALive 6910 Cutting Tree 并查集
- 原生js--异步请求
- 用JDBC如何调用存储过程
- Django 知识点补充
- BZOJ 1211 树的计数(purfer序列)
- mysql DATE_FORMAT 年月日时分秒格式化
- 基于vue框架项目开发过程中遇到的问题总结(三)